What was Alfred Russel Wallace's stance on social issues?
Alfred Russel Wallace was a progressive thinker who often addressed social issues. He was an advocate for social reform and had interests in land nationalization and equality, proposing ideas to improve the welfare of the lower classes. Wallace's writings and beliefs often reflected his sympathy for socialism and criticism of social injustices, which were influenced by the disparities he observed during his scientific explorations.
